Rare and exquisite Staffordshire pottery figure group dating back to circa 1852. This charming piece portrays the iconic lovers Romeo and Juliet in a tender embrace. The intricate details show Romeo in a cloak and plumed hat, while Juliet is elegantly dressed in a long gown.
Seated upon a naturalistic base, the figures are depicted with their arms lovingly entwined. Standing at a height of 20cm, this antique Staffordshire pottery figure group captures the timeless romance of Shakespeare's tragic tale.
